Overview
This study investigates the activity of the NLRP3 inflammasome in human dendritic cells through the measurement of IL-1尾 secretion. By utilizing R848 to induce pro-IL-1尾 expression and nigericin for inflammasome activation, researchers can assess the priming and activation of dendritic cells.

Methods Used
- Induction of pro-IL-1尾 expression using R848.
- Activation of NLRP3 inflammasome with nigericin.
- Measurement of intracellular and extracellular IL-1尾 levels.
- Utilization of immunofluorescence, western blot, and ELISA techniques.
Main Results
- R848 priming leads to increased intracellular pro-IL-1尾 production.
- Nigericin activation results in the secretion of mature IL-1尾.
- Both primed and activated dendritic cells show significant IL-1尾 expression.
- Assays effectively measure NLRP3 inflammasome activity.

What is the role of dendritic cells in the immune system?
Dendritic cells are essential for processing and presenting antigens to T cells, thus initiating the adaptive immune response.
How does R848 affect dendritic cells?
R848 is a TLR8 agonist that induces the expression of pro-inflammatory cytokines, including pro-IL-1尾 in dendritic cells.
What is the significance of IL-1尾 in inflammation?
IL-1尾 is a potent pro-inflammatory cytokine that plays a critical role in mediating inflammatory responses and activating immune cells.
What techniques are used to measure IL-1尾 levels?
Techniques such as immunofluorescence, western blotting, and ELISA are commonly used to quantify IL-1尾 levels in cell samples.
What does NLRP3 inflammasome activation indicate?
NLRP3 inflammasome activation indicates a cellular response to stress or danger signals, leading to the production of IL-1尾 and inflammation.
